Not all bets are created equal. Some are simple win/lose propositions, while others offer intricate layers of excitement. For example, moneyline bets are the most straightforward, requiring you only to pick the winner. Meanwhile, point spreads challenge you to predict the margin of victory, and over/under bets focus on total scores rather than outcomes.
What makes these markets fascinating is their diversity and how they appeal differently depending on your level of expertise and risk appetite. While some bettors thrive on the adrenaline of complex parlays and prop bets—those wagers on individual player performances or specific game events—others prefer sticking to cleaner bets that don’t demand hours of research.

While the thrill of a good sports bet is undeniable, it’s essential to approach it with a responsible mindset. Setting limits, understanding the odds, and recognizing when to step back are crucial habits for anyone interested in betting. After all, the goal is to enhance your enjoyment of sports, not to create financial risks or stress.
Remember, sports betting should be part of a balanced lifestyle, and it’s always wise to use tools such as self-exclusion options or deposit limits offered by many platforms.
